Designing Fonts Without Borders: A Complete Guide to Creating Multilingual & Multi-Script Typefaces
Designing Fonts Without Borders: A Complete Guide to Creating Multilingual & Multi-Script Typefaces
In today’s global design landscape, typography plays a crucial role in cross-cultural communication. Brands, publications, and digital platforms are no longer confined to a single language or region—they must speak to diverse audiences across continents. That’s where multilingual or multi-script fonts come into play. But designing a typeface that works flawlessly across Latin, Cyrillic, Arabic, Devanagari, Thai, or Han characters isn’t just about expanding glyph sets—it’s about understanding visual harmony, cultural nuance, and technical consistency.
If you’re a type designer looking to create a font that transcends language barriers, this comprehensive guide will walk you through the core principles, challenges, and solutions of making a multilingual or multi-script font.
1. Understand What “Multilingual” and “Multi-Script” Truly Mean

Before jumping into glyphs and masters, let’s clarify definitions:
- Multilingual font: A font that supports multiple languages, typically within the same script. For example, a Latin-based font supporting English, French, German, Turkish, and Vietnamese.
- Multi-script font: A font that includes glyphs from entirely different writing systems, such as Latin + Cyrillic, Latin + Arabic, or even Latin + Chinese.
Both terms require you to think globally—linguistically, culturally, and visually.
2. Start with Language and Script Planning

Designing for multiple scripts begins with research and planning.
- Define your target languages. Will your font be used in Europe only, or should it work in Asia and the Middle East too?
- Understand the required scripts. For example, to support Hindi, you need Devanagari; for Russian, Cyrillic; for Japanese, you may need Latin, Kana, and Kanji.
Tip: Refer to Unicode charts and language support databases like Hyperglot, Unicode.org, or CLDR to determine which glyphs are necessary for each language or script.
3. Master Cross-Script Aesthetic Harmony

The biggest challenge in multi-script design is visual consistency.
- Match the personality: A serif Latin font with sharp wedge serifs needs a similarly expressive design in Cyrillic or Arabic.
- Respect script traditions: Don’t force Latin aesthetics into non-Latin scripts. Each script has evolved within its own visual and cultural context.
- Baseline and proportion alignment: Ensure that x-height, cap height, and descenders translate naturally across scripts without distortion.
Pro Tip: Study successful multi-script font families like Noto, Skolar, or TPTQ Arabic to see how harmony is achieved.
4. Hire or Collaborate with Native Designers
Even the most talented Latin script designers can unintentionally misrepresent a script they don’t read or write. That’s why collaboration is key.
- Partner with native type designers or calligraphers.
- Get feedback from language experts on legibility and tone.
- Test your font in real-world settings using native texts.
This step is critical for complex scripts like Arabic, Hebrew, or Thai, where reading direction, diacritic positioning, and ligatures are essential to readability.
5. Expand Your Glyph Set the Smart Way

Here’s a sample breakdown of what you might include in a multilingual/multi-script font:
- Latin Extended-A and B for full European coverage
- Vietnamese-specific diacritics
- Cyrillic Basic and Extended for Slavic and Central Asian languages
- Greek, Arabic, Devanagari, Thai, Hangul, etc., depending on your scope
Use tools like FontLab, Glyphs, or RoboFont to manage these extended character sets efficiently.
6. Tackle Technical Complexity

Don’t underestimate the technical engineering behind multi-script fonts:
- Use OpenType features for contextual alternates, ligatures, and mark positioning.
- Ensure Unicode mapping is accurate for each glyph.
- Pay close attention to kerning, diacritic anchoring, and script-specific behaviors (like right-to-left rendering in Arabic or Hebrew).
Variable fonts can also be multilingual, but require additional testing across scripts to maintain quality across axes (weight, width, slant).
7. Testing, Localization, and Iteration
Once your font is ready, test it in:
- Web environments
- Print layouts
- UI/UX contexts
- Multilingual paragraphs
Run test sets in each script, in both body text and display sizes. Look out for issues like broken ligatures, incorrect alignment, or inconsistent rhythm.
Also, consult with local users or beta testers. Their feedback is invaluable and can highlight cultural missteps or legibility issues that are easy to miss.
8. Documentation and Marketing

When publishing your font:
- Clearly list the languages and scripts supported.
- Showcase multilingual text samples in your visuals.
- Provide PDFs or specimen booklets that show the font in action across multiple writing systems.
This not only helps designers choose your font confidently, but also improves your reputation as a responsible and culturally-aware type designer.
Conclusion
Creating a multilingual or multi-script font isn’t just about drawing more letters—it’s about bridging worlds. As a designer, you are responsible for crafting tools that facilitate understanding across cultures, geographies, and languages.
With careful research, collaboration, technical precision, and respect for each script’s heritage, your typeface can become a powerful tool of global communication—one glyph at a time.